A Deep Dive into a Single Serving: Unpacking the Macronutrients

Let's start with a typical serving size: approximately 1 ounce (about 30 pistachios). This provides a concrete foundation for our analysis; While the exact macronutrient breakdown can vary slightly depending on factors like pistachio variety and growing conditions, we can establish a representative profile:

  • Carbohydrates: Approximately 8 grams. This includes both fiber and net carbs. A crucial distinction for keto dieters lies in understanding *net carbs*. Net carbs are calculated by subtracting fiber from total carbohydrates. Fiber, being indigestible, doesn't significantly impact blood sugar levels. Thus, it's typically excluded from the net carb count.
  • Net Carbs: Usually around 5-6 grams per ounce. This is the figure most relevant for keto dieters as it reflects the carbohydrate impact on ketosis.
  • Fat: Approximately 13 grams. This is a significant source of healthy fats, contributing to satiety and providing energy.
  • Protein: Approximately 6 grams. Pistachios offer a decent amount of protein, supporting muscle maintenance and overall health.

Nutritional Value Beyond Macros: A Holistic Perspective

Pistachios offer more than just macronutrients. They're a good source of several essential nutrients including:

  • Vitamin E: A powerful antioxidant protecting cells from damage.
  • Potassium: Crucial for maintaining proper fluid balance and nerve function.
  • Magnesium: Important for muscle and nerve function, blood sugar control, and blood pressure regulation.
  • Fiber: Promotes digestive health and contributes to satiety.
  • Antioxidants: Various antioxidants help combat oxidative stress and reduce the risk of chronic diseases.

Potential Drawbacks and Considerations

Despite their nutritional benefits, pistachios present certain considerations for keto dieters:

  • Calorie Density: Pistachios are relatively calorie-dense. While healthy fats contribute to satiety, overconsumption can hinder weight loss goals.
  • Potential for Blood Sugar Spikes (though low): Even with low net carbs, some individuals may experience a mild blood sugar increase. Individual responses vary greatly.
  • Affordability and Accessibility: Pistachios can be more expensive than other nuts, limiting access for some.
  • Allergies: As with any nut, allergies are a potential concern.

The Keto Verdict: Moderation and Individualized Approach

The question "Are pistachios keto-approved?" doesn't have a simple yes or no answer. A moderate intake of pistachios (within daily carb limits) can be part of a well-planned ketogenic diet. However, individuals highly sensitive to carbohydrates might need to consume them sparingly or avoid them altogether. Always monitor your ketone levels and blood glucose to gauge your personal response.

Addressing Common Misconceptions

Many misconceptions surround keto-friendly snacks. One common fallacy is that all nuts are created equal regarding their carb content. This is demonstrably false, as we've seen with pistachios. Another misconception is that small amounts of carbs are insignificant. Even small excesses can impact ketosis, especially for individuals highly sensitive to carbohydrates.
